  "textContent": "A membrane/electrode assembly for solid polymer fuel cells is disclosed wherein a fluorinated sulfonic acid polymer having a monomer unit represented by the following general formula (3): (3) (wherein, Rf 1 represents a divalent perfluorohydrocarbon group having 4-10 carbon atoms) is used for at least one of the membrane and the catalyst binder. The fluorinated sulfonic acid polymer has a melt flow rate (MFR) of not more than 100 g/10 min at 270°C when the -SO 3 H group in the polymer is changed into -SO 2 F.",
